North Plympton Child Care FAQ
What is the Child Care supply composition of North Plympton?
As of our last update on August 2, 2026, there are 2 child care centres in North Plympton. Of these, 2 centres provide Long Day Care with 190 places. There are no schools in the area with student enrolment data at present.
What population do these centres in North Plympton service?
AreaSearch's latest population estimate for North Plympton as at May 2026 stands at a total of 4,065 people, of this 208 are estimated to be children under five years of age.
Why do your population numbers differ from Census figures for North Plympton?
Some areas have changed considerably since the 2021 Census was undertaken. At the 2021 Census North Plympton was assessed as having 3,610 people with 199 of these (5.5%) being children under 5yo. North Plympton has seen 41 new addresses added since this time, which, combined with broader ABS population estimates for resident population, leads us to estimate that North Plympton has experienced population growth of approximately 455 people from the 2021 Census.
How does the ratio of children per LDC place in North Plympton compare to those in Greater Adelaide?
In North Plympton, our latest analysis shows there are 1.1 resident children under 5yo per LDC place. This figure is significantly lower than the 2.2 children per place across Greater Adelaide.
How do childcare fees in North Plympton relate to those in Greater Adelaide?
Childcare fees in North Plympton average $171, which is slightly higher than the regional average of $159 in Greater Adelaide.
How does the ratio of school population per LDC place compare in North Plympton and Greater Adelaide?
There are no schools reporting attendance in North Plympton, while there is an average of 6.4 students per LDC place across Greater Adelaide.
What is the average age of Long Daycare Centres in North Plympton?
The average LDC in North Plympton was approved 7.4 years ago, while across Greater Adelaide the typical centre approval is 10 years old.
Is the local workforce a significant driver of additional child care demand for North Plympton?
Yes, workforce activity is significant in this area and is likely a key driver of child care demand.
Who would typically use analysis such as this?
Childcare operators, developers, investors and financiers would typically conduct a thorough child care supply and demand analysis (SDA) on North Plympton before allocating the significant amount of capital required. Boundary-based analysis such as this is often used as an initial guide however, and analysis would be undertaken on the specific site adopting a radial, travel time, or custom catchment to take into account nearby competition and demand drivers that would influence a centre's performance.
